Add 45/42 and 20/40
1st number: 1 3/42, 2nd number: 20/40
45/42 + 20/40 is 11/7.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 42 and 40 is 840
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 840 - For the 1st fraction, since 42 × 20 = 840,
45/42 = 45 × 20/42 × 20 = 900/840 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 40 × 21 = 840,
20/40 = 20 × 21/40 × 21 = 420/840 - Add the two like fractions:
900/840 + 420/840 = 900 + 420/840 = 1320/840 - 1320/840 simplified gives 11/7
- So, 45/42 + 20/40 = 11/7
